How they compare

Curaçao currently reports 1.86 billion current LCU against 1.82 billion current LCU in Montenegro, a difference of 32.03 million current LCU.

Across all 14 years both countries report, Curaçao has been ahead every year.

Curaçao ranks 169th and Montenegro ranks 171st of 180 countries.

Curaçao has averaged higher in every one of the 2 decades both report.

Gross fixed capital formation includes acquisitions less disposals of fixed assets during the accounting period, including certain specified expenditures on services that add to the value of non-produced assets. This indicator is expressed in current prices, meaning no adjustment has been made to account for price changes over time. This series is expressed in local currency units.
